If it shifts into 4hi and 4lo ok but is not locking in the front axle, check to make sure your hubs are engaing right. Sometimes automatic hubs need taken apart, cleaned and regreased. If they are ok but the front actuator isnt working then check to make sure the switching valves are working and vacuum is ok. If those are alright then the front actuator might be stuck and need replaced.
